Description

This stunning property has been carefully extended to offer the mix of modern living and comfort with a carefully planned rear extension offering the perfect place to entertain and yet still providing a comfortable and cosy family home.

Shenfield Mainline Railway Station (Elizabeth Line) and its popular high street with an array of restaurants and shops are located just 1.2 miles away. It is also in catchment for some excellent local schools (subject to acceptance).

The ground floor has a welcoming hallway with stairs to the first floor, under stairs storage, access to the separate front reception room for those relaxing evenings in and leads through to the extended kitchen/lounge/diner which gives this home the wow factor.

The rear extension offers the ideal open plan living space with a beautiful modern fitted kitchen. The kitchen itself has an array of base and eye level units, solid wood worktops and space for appliances including room for a free standing range cooker.

The Living/dining area with bifold doors that lead out to the garden and lantern skylight fill this room with natural light and this area has ample room to set up this space to suit your preferences. Furthermore there is a utility/storage cupboard with space to house the washing machine and tumble dryer and a ground floor cloakroom via a small inner hall with door leading to the side of the garden.

The first floor has a good sized landing with loft access and a window to the side providing natural light. There are three generous bedrooms with the principal bedroom being the largest and a modern family bathroom.

Externally, the property features a large well-maintained garden, south facing with lots of sunshine, a patio area perfect for outdoor entertaining, off-street parking via a partly shared drive, and large outbuilding/shed with electricity, ideal to create a home office/gym.

Located in a sought-after residential area this home gives you the opportunity to enjoy a peaceful evening in the garden or hosting a gathering with friends, this property offers a versatile living space to suit all your needs, with the possibility to extend out to the side or into the loft (subject to planning consents) don't miss out on making this your new family home.
